From 92a551b96e625257def26771155ebd64c6d8757e Mon Sep 17 00:00:00 2001 From: Christian Pointner Date: Sun, 29 Jun 2014 00:06:23 +0000 Subject: fixed not working singletons - still not threadsafe but at least they don't pretend to be --- src/signalController.h | 13 ------------- 1 file changed, 13 deletions(-) (limited to 'src/signalController.h') diff --git a/src/signalController.h b/src/signalController.h index a0d417b..ebd2942 100644 --- a/src/signalController.h +++ b/src/signalController.h @@ -69,19 +69,6 @@ private: SignalController(const SignalController& s); void operator=(const SignalController& s); - static SignalController* inst; - static Mutex instMutex; - class instanceCleaner - { - public: - ~instanceCleaner() { - if(SignalController::inst != NULL) { - delete SignalController::inst; - } - } - }; - friend class instanceCleaner; - typedef std::pair SigPair; std::queue sigQueue; Mutex sigQueueMutex; -- cgit v1.2.3